  • In microalgal biotechnology, aimed to the production of biomass, high-value products, or even bio-fuels, has prompted the application of on-line measurements for monitoring growth and obtaining rapid evidence of unfavourable conditions affecting the performance of outdoor cultures. The aim of this chapter is to provide a simple, practical guide to the use of chlorophyll fluorescence for microalgal biotechnologists who wish to apply this technique in microalgal mass cultures, both in field and laboratory studies. Whilst the principles behind the measurements will be mentioned briefly, the emphasis will be given to the applications and limitations of this technique for monitoring in situ and its implications
